1. USE COMMON SENSE

BACKCOUNTRY TRAVEL IS A RISKY ACTIVITY, SUBJECT TO INFLUENCE BY NUMEROUS VARIABLES BEYOND THE CONTROL OF PARTICIPANTS. IT CAN INVOLVE RISK OF DEATH OR SERIOUS INJURY. PARTICIPANTS ARE ENCOURAGED TO TAKE RELEVANT EDUCATIONAL COURSES BEFORE ENGAGING IN BACKCOUNTRY ACTIVITIES. USE OF THIS APP CANNOT GUARANTEE RESCUE. USE GOOD JUDGEMENT ON YOUR BACKCOUNTRY ADVENTURES. Use of this app may result in the dispatch of search and rescue personnel. These individuals often risk their own safety in the process of facilitating a rescue. In addition, search and rescue organizations may incur substantial costs in facilitating a rescue.

Accordingly, use this app only if you or a companion are lost, injured, or in a life-threatening situation. Anyone abusing the functionality of this app may be prosecuted to the fullest extent allowed by law.

EFFECTIVENESS OF THIS APPLICATION IS DEPENDENT UPON PERFORMANCE OF YOUR PHONE’S CELLULAR SERVICE. IF YOU ARE IN AN AREA WITHOUT CELLULAR SERVICE COVERAGE, YOUR MESSAGES MAY NOT REACH SEARCH AND RESCUE PERSONNEL. DO NOT DEPEND UPON THIS APPLICATION IN AREAS IN WHICH YOUR PHONE DOES NOT HAVE CELLULAR SERVICE COVERAGE.

5. Your privacy and your rights

We are committed to providing transparency in how we collect and use data.

This App is designed to facilitate use of your device’s GPS to determine your location in the event of an emergency. The App does not directly share your location with us or any third party; rather, you can use the App to automatically compose an SMS message containing your location that you may choose to send to local emergency personnel. Sending the message requires your affirmative election to do so and is dependent upon available cellular service coverage.

Other than this use of location data, and the resulting transmittal of your cellular telephone number, the App does not collect any information from or about you.
